My friend is ok but a cager ran a red light and my buddy never saw him coming. It was a 4 lane road he was turning on to and the cager was in the last lane so no way to see the car. He basically got clipped on the side and threw him several feet in the air and his bike was thrown about 15-20 feet away. He is being sent home from the ER with a 2 broken bones in his ankle (surgery will be later), busted knuckle, shoulder is messed up but nothing on the xrays, and his tooth went through his upper lip. Overall he is very good for how the bike looks. He had all his typical gear on, half helmet, gloves, leather jacket, and leather boots. He just converted from sport to a Harley and the bike wasnt even 3 weeks old.

Cager got arrested for suspicion of DWI (possibly drugged up at the time) and car was impounded. Just be careful.
